KDE Invent is the collaborative code hosting platform for the KDE community, built on GitLab. Here, you can browse and join different public and internal groups, each focused on various open source projects and development initiatives within KDE.
Whether you're a developer looking to contribute code, a designer interested in improving KDE apps, or simply curious about the community’s work, you’ll find an organized space to connect with others. You can request to join groups, participate in discussions, and work together on KDE’s software ecosystem.
The platform is designed to make collaboration easy, offering a familiar GitLab interface for code hosting, version control, and project management. It’s a hub for anyone passionate about open source and the KDE project.
